Quarterly Planning Note — Board

The Revane plant is at 94% utilisation and the Solsten line cannot absorb projected demand beyond Q2 next year. Options assessed: a third shift at Revane, outsourcing finishing to a contract partner, or committing to the Hartbeck expansion. Management recommends the expansion, with the shift addition as a bridge. Capital outlay falls within the envelope discussed in March. Outsourcing is not recommended on quality grounds. The confidential rationale and timing considerations follow below.

board note of yadup-fajef: Druiusox Holdings is in early talks to buy Norwynek Systems for about $186.0 million. The Kaseth launch date is June 24, and nothing goes to the press before then. Legal wants the Quenethek Group term sheet withdrawn before November 27.

Ticket: staging env for Spokeshift broken. The rebalancing optimizer can't reach the dock-occupancy feed because staging was cloned from the old Tarnsby cluster config, which points at a decommissioned endpoint. Fix: update FEED_BASE_URL in .env to the new occupancy service and remove the stale TARNSBY_REGION key entirely. Reviewer: please verify the diff only touches staging, not the prod overlay — last time a cloned .env leaked prod values into CI. The feed also requires auth now, so the .env must gain the following line.

vault entry, yahif-yajep: COURIER_KEY29=b802bdf8034096b65a51c6ba5abe2

Night-Shift Access — Support Team (Hallowick Annex). Support staff on the 22:00–06:00 rotation enter via door C2 only. Main lobby locked after 21:30. Log all entries in the desk register. Escalations go to the Quorrel facilities line. Badge readers on C2 run in offline mode overnight. Issue night staff the standing access code below.

badge for bahop-kahop: bdg-YHM-0

**Q: What's the deal with the lifts on weekends?**

Heads up, night crew: the lifts at Marrowgate House get their monthly once-over every second Saturday, usually between 01:00 and 05:00. During that window, use the east stairwell to move between floors. The stairwell door on level 3 locks automatically after midnight, so you'll need the pass code to get back through. Here it is for reference:

door code, yagap-bahof: bdg-O-05